SORU
23 Mart 2010, Salı


Hızlı yönlendirme kapalı gıt varsayılan olarak yapabilir miyim?

Gerçekten şimdiye kadar git merge yerine git rebase kullanırdım bir zaman düşünemiyorumdeğilbir haritayı işlemek için istiyor. Git varsayılan olarak kapalı hızlı yönlendirme için yapılandırmak için bir yolu var mı? --ff bir seçenek daha var aslında bir yolu var olduğunu ima etmek gibi görünüyor, ama belgelerinde bulmak için görünmüyor olabilir.

CEVAP
23 Mart 2010, Salı


Evet, --no-ff. Şube başına seçenekleri, örneğin birleştirme yapılandırabilirsiniz

git config branch.master.mergeoptions  "--no-ff"

ekler $(REPO)/.git/config dosyanızı aşağıdaki:

[branch "master"]
    mergeoptions = --no-ff

Dipnot: konuşma benim deneyim, ben sonunda buldum geçiş hızlı ileri sarmak için kapalıydı çoğunlukla yararlı için git yeni gelenler - ancak bir kez hissetmek için iş akışları ve kavramlar başlamak için lavaboya kesinlikle önlemek istiyorsanız bulanıklık günlük grafik ton ile anlamsız 'birleştirilmiş uzak ..blarf' türü tamamlar.

Bunu Paylaş:
  • Google+
  • E-Posta
Etiketler:

YORUMLAR

SPONSOR VİDEO

Rastgele Yazarlar

  • Andrey Menshikov

    Andrey Mensh

    28 Ocak 2012
  • Smith Micro Graphics

    Smith Micro

    15 Mayıs 2008
  • TopDJMag TV

    TopDJMag TV

    29 Temmuz 2010